Well the 9500 GT is 6.875 inches long (Couldn't find any specs on the 9500 GS cause it's an OEM card, but it's based on the 9500 GT so I'm assuming the same size). The GTX 550ti is 8.25 Inches long. Does it look like there is an extra ~1.5 inches of clearance in your case?

And you definitely need a new PSU if you are going to upgrade. Antec, Seasonic, Corsair, PC Power & Cooling, XFX, and Enermax all make good PSUs.
